Rac and Rho compete to cooperate

Abstract: Antagonism between RhoA and Rac1 pathways creates cell heterogeneity that aids epidermal morphogenesis.

“…Altogether these results suggest that the role of IpgB1 during cell-to-cell spread is to activate Rac1 to antagonize the recruitment of RhoA (Fig 9, Wild Type). The spatial and temporal antagonism between Rac1 and RhoA has been well documented in the cell biology field [27][28][29][30][31][32]. During cell migration, Rac1 and RhoA are found predominantly at the leading and trailing edges of the cell, respectively [31].…”
